What is coaching?

“Coaching is about enabling individuals to make conscious decisions and empowering them to become leaders in their own lives”. Coaching is a useful way of developing people’s skills and abilities, and of boosting performance to achieve their full potential. It can also help deal with issues and challenges before they become major problems.

A coaching session usually takes place as a conversation between the coach and the coachee (person being coached), and focuses on helping the coachee discover answers for themselves. It is helping them to learn rather than teaching them as people are much more likely to engage with solutions that they have come up with themselves, rather than those that are forced upon them!
